From c149a173898f62714e6afb845a9fff004e921e17 Mon Sep 17 00:00:00 2001 From: Nicholas Nethercote Date: Sun, 9 Aug 2009 23:27:00 +0000 Subject: [PATCH] Make usage messages given by -h and man pages consistent for the scripts. git-svn-id: svn://svn.valgrind.org/valgrind/trunk@10756 --- cachegrind/cg_annotate.in | 2 +- cachegrind/docs/cg_annotate-manpage.xml | 3 ++- callgrind/callgrind_annotate.in | 2 +- callgrind/callgrind_control.in | 2 +- callgrind/docs/callgrind_annotate-manpage.xml | 4 +++- callgrind/docs/callgrind_control-manpage.xml | 2 +- massif/docs/ms_print-manpage.xml | 3 ++- massif/ms_print.in | 2 +- 8 files changed, 12 insertions(+), 8 deletions(-) diff --git a/cachegrind/cg_annotate.in b/cachegrind/cg_annotate.in index 83f348310c..29d94264eb 100644 --- a/cachegrind/cg_annotate.in +++ b/cachegrind/cg_annotate.in @@ -142,7 +142,7 @@ my $version = "@VERSION@"; # Usage message. my $usage = < cg_annotate options - filename + cachegrind-out-file + source-files diff --git a/callgrind/callgrind_annotate.in b/callgrind/callgrind_annotate.in index 60ecde0bab..5f7393dcd8 100644 --- a/callgrind/callgrind_annotate.in +++ b/callgrind/callgrind_annotate.in @@ -196,7 +196,7 @@ my $version = "@VERSION@"; # Usage message. my $usage = <| ...]\n\n"; + print "Usage: callgrind_control [options] [pid|program-name...]\n\n"; print "If no pids/names are given, an action is applied to all currently\n"; print "active Callgrind runs. Default action is printing short information.\n\n"; print "Options:\n"; diff --git a/callgrind/docs/callgrind_annotate-manpage.xml b/callgrind/docs/callgrind_annotate-manpage.xml index a1d8aa8dec..2d0482b1ab 100644 --- a/callgrind/docs/callgrind_annotate-manpage.xml +++ b/callgrind/docs/callgrind_annotate-manpage.xml @@ -21,7 +21,9 @@ callgrind_annotate options - source-files + + callgrind-out-file + source-files diff --git a/callgrind/docs/callgrind_control-manpage.xml b/callgrind/docs/callgrind_control-manpage.xml index dd71af0afb..952a1c0c13 100644 --- a/callgrind/docs/callgrind_control-manpage.xml +++ b/callgrind/docs/callgrind_control-manpage.xml @@ -20,7 +20,7 @@ callgrind_control options - pid/program-name + pid|program-name diff --git a/massif/docs/ms_print-manpage.xml b/massif/docs/ms_print-manpage.xml index 835d49bcfb..cd1f4a061c 100644 --- a/massif/docs/ms_print-manpage.xml +++ b/massif/docs/ms_print-manpage.xml @@ -10,6 +10,7 @@ ms_print 1 Release &rel-version; + rel-date @@ -21,7 +22,7 @@ ms_print options - filename + massif-out-file diff --git a/massif/ms_print.in b/massif/ms_print.in index 2b2a412395..e6ffdbff8d 100755 --- a/massif/ms_print.in +++ b/massif/ms_print.in @@ -62,7 +62,7 @@ my $ms_print_args; # Usage message. my $usage = < +usage: ms_print [options] massif-out-file options for the user, with defaults in [ ], are: -h --help show this message -- 2.47.2